Advanced Hydropower Emergency Response Planning: UK Career Outlook


Career Role (Hydropower Emergency Response) Description
Hydropower Emergency Response Manager Leads emergency response teams, develops and implements plans, ensuring compliance and safety protocols within hydropower operations.
Hydropower Engineer (Emergency Planning) Specializes in designing and maintaining hydropower facilities with emergency preparedness as a primary focus, minimizing risk and enhancing resilience.
Dam Safety Inspector (Hydropower) Inspects and assesses dam structures, identifying potential hazards and recommending necessary emergency actions for hydropower facilities.
Emergency Response Technician (Hydropower) Provides on-site support during emergencies, handling equipment and executing pre-planned procedures in hydropower installations.
Hydropower Risk Assessor Conducts thorough risk assessments, analyzing potential hazards and developing mitigation strategies for hydropower emergency scenarios.
